Poetic Language as a Foundation for Scientific Innovation

Category: Innovation & Design · Effect: Moderate effect · Year: 2022

The evocative and meaning-laden nature of poetic language is crucial for the development and acceptance of scientific theories, suggesting a deeper connection between creativity and scientific progress.

Research Evidence

Aim: To explore the role of poetic language in the epistemology and ontology of physics and its influence on scientific theory acceptance.

Method: Philosophical analysis and historical case study.

Procedure: The study analyzes the philosophical underpinnings of physics, particularly focusing on how language shapes understanding. It uses developments in thermodynamics as an example and examines an ancient artifact with a palaeo-Hebrew inscription to demonstrate the historical primacy of poetic language in conveying meaning.

Context: Philosophy of Science, Physics, Linguistics

Limitations

The study is primarily philosophical and may not offer direct empirical data on the measurable impact of poetic language on specific design outcomes.
